Sifchain announced that it has successfully deployed a Peggy (Cosmos <> Ethereum bridge) on its Merry-Go-Round testnet. Sifchain is a cryptocurrency exchange protocol built on Cosmos SDK and will target 20–25 blockchains (such as Ethereum and Stellar) for cross-chain integration. It will also simplify the process of blockchain integration, lowering the development process for the Cosmos community so that additional cross-chain integrations will be cost minimized in terms of money and developer resources.
Sifchain’s goal is for new blockchains to consider cross-chain integration as essential as a wallet or block explorer. Liquidity from all cryptocurrencies can then be accessed on-chain, allowing the coordinated deployment of capital from all cryptocurrencies by DAOs.
Sifchain has deployed a persistent deployment of Peggy on a standing testnet, in parallel with Althea’s version of Peggy. Sifchain leverages the power of the Cosmos SDK to deploy a Peggy chain on mainnet. Sifchain uses Cosmos’ master branch Peggy with work created by a Swish Labs team under an Interchain Foundation grant. Like Althea Peggy, Sifchain’s approach to Peggy allows users of ETH and ERC-20 tokens on Ethereum to create pegged tokens on a Cosmos Network chain.

Tendermint Core 0.34 introduces support for state sync. This allows a new node to join a network by fetching a snapshot of the application state at a recent height instead of fetching and replaying all historical blocks. Since the application state is generally much smaller than the blocks, and restoring it is much faster than replaying blocks, this can reduce the time to sync with the network from days to minutes.
This article provides a brief overview of the Tendermint state sync protocol for application developers. For more details, please refer to the ABCI application guide and the ABCI reference documentation.
Cosmos SDK 0.40 includes automatic support for state sync, so developers using it do not need to implement the state sync protocol described in this article themselves. #35 Cosmos Stargate Hub Upgrade Proposal 2: Time to Upgrade
Proposal to complete the Stargate upgrade, halt `cosmoshub-3` at 06:00 UTC on Jan 28th, export the state and start `cosmoshub-4` based on gaia 3.0.
#34 Luna Mission — Funding $ATOM
The Cosmos Hub (ATOM) community is requesting a community pool spend amount of 129,208 ATOM in order to implement a comprehensive ATOM marketing plan that will be executed in collaboration with AiB (Tendermint). The marketing efforts will be initiated immediately upon passing of proposal #34.
The distribution of funds will be administered by 5 community members, that have been carefully selected by the community via the Cosmos governance working group to administer the marketing plan and release funds to either AiB that will act as a liaison between Cosmos Hub community and third parties or directly to parties that will be in charge of executing the marketing plan based on a majority multisignature approval. At least 3 members will have to approve each milestone-spend for it to be released to AiB based on the expected proposal scope & completion.

The InterNFT Working Group is drafting a set of Interchain standards that will advance the state of the art for Non-fungible Tokens and the Metadata associated with uniquely identified tokenised resources. Their mission is to make NFTs interoperable across blockchain networks and to enable ownership, control and rights management of NFT metadata and linked resources, regardless of where these are located.
This article provides a brief update on what we have achieved in the first phase of this work, since the working group started meeting in September. Looking ahead, we expect to formalise draft Interchain standards by the end of Q1 2021. These will have reference implementations in the Cosmos SDK.
